Cannabiotix Gluetopia Premiere: The Version of This Strain That Isn't Raw Garden's or Copycat Genetix's
Three different brands sell something called Gluetopia, and they're not the same strain. Cannabiotix's version crosses their own CBX Glue with Zereal Milk #97, grown indoors under the brand's Premiere tier.

Search 'Gluetopia' across enough dispensary menus and you'll pull up at least three unrelated strains. Raw Garden sells a Gluetopia built from Original Glue × Jack Punch. Copycat Genetix has its own Gluetopia S1, a straight Gorilla Glue backcross. Cannabiotix's version is a third, entirely separate cross — CBX Glue run into Zereal Milk #97, both in-house selections that don't show up on Leafly, AllBud, or SeedFinder outside of CBX's own catalog. Same name, three different jars, and it matters which one you're actually buying.
CBX has earned the benefit of the doubt on genetics claims like this one. The brand's been running its own breeding and cultivation program out of a 71,000-square-foot Southern California facility since 2014, backed by 15-plus Cannabis Cup placements across the decade — White Walker OG, Master Kush, and Kush Mountains among the wins. Gluetopia runs through the Premiere Indoor tier, the everyday jar that sits below the brand's hand-selected Big Buds line but still gets the full indoor treatment.
The cross makes sense on paper: CBX Glue for the fuel-heavy backbone every Gorilla Glue-family strain brings, Zereal Milk #97 — the brand's own worked pheno of the Cereal Milk line — for a creamy, dessert-adjacent counterweight. CBX's own tasting notes call it chocolatey, tangy, and hashy, while independent reviewers at AllBud describe something closer to citrus and berry with a vanilla exhale. Both are probably right; live and fresh-frozen crosses like this one tend to shift meaningfully from batch to batch, and that's part of the appeal rather than a red flag.
Current Premiere tier batches are testing at 28% THC, with a myrcene-limonene-pinene backbone; CBX's own posted range runs as high as 34% on select harvests. The buds themselves run purple-hued and heavily crystal-coated, and the effect leans euphoric and soothing rather than sedating — a gentler ride than the strain's glue-forward nose suggests.
If you've had a Gluetopia before and it didn't match this description, you were probably smoking someone else's version. This one's Cannabiotix's, top to bottom.
